Abstract :
The paper refers briefly to the d.c. electrification and to some operating statistics on the Indian Railways and gives a few details of the electrification schemes undertaken in the Second and Third Five-Year Plans, using a 25 kV single-phase industrial-frequency system. Power supply arrangements, traction overhead equipment, ancillary civil, signalling and telecommunication engineering work and a.c. rolling stock are described. It outlines the technical improvements made in fixed installations and rolling stock in the light of experience gained so far, the organisation set up for the execution of electrification projects and the efforts made to develop the manufacture of rolling stock and other equipment in India.
